During her teenage years, award-winning author Sharon E. Cathcart dreamed of working in the music business. She lived that dream for seven years, beginning at age 18. Unfortunately, she learned that sometimes dreams turn quickly to nightmares. Updated for 2015, to answer the question: "where are they now?"

Review Anyone who enjoys coming of age books and books chronicling the music scene will adore this book. It's filled with anecdotes about the Portland (OR) music scene of the 1980s and is peopled with vividly drawn characters. - Cialan Haasnic, author of "Homegrown: The Terror Within"
About the Author Books by award-winning internationally published author Sharon E. Cathcart provide discerning readers of essays, fiction and non-fiction with a powerful, truthful literary experience. Her primary focus is on creating fiction featuring atypical characters. A former journalist and newspaper editor, Sharon has written for as long as she can remember and generally has at least one work in progress. Sharon lives with her husband and an assortment of pets in the Silicon Valley, California.

A good book for taking a nostalgic look back By Amazon Customer Sharon Cathcart gives an interesting and playful look at what was happening in Portland's music scene in the early eighties. It's very clear that this same scene played a large part in helping Sharon, who was a young and innocent woman at the time, find herself.Though it wanders more than a few times into her personal life, I can see why it did the wandering. What was written about the bands and their members was inside information that wouldn't have been available to someone who wasn't personally smack in the middle of it all. With her meandering she gives credence to her story.A good book for taking a nostalgic look back. Being from the Portland area, it was a real treat to read this book. The memories it brought back were treasures I had nearly forgotten.
1 of 1 people found the following review helpful. A Blast From the Past! By Book Maven This book really took me back. As someone who was there and lived through some of this stuff, I can say, quite emphatically, that Sharon Cathcart has hit the nail on the head with her insightful, storytelling skill. She perfectly captures the mood and spirit of that scene at that time – the excitement, the disappointment, the insanity, and the expectation. She swiftly covers quite a bit of ground, but never gets ahead of herself. And things never slow down and get dull, either. It’s a vigorous and fun read. I was a member of one of the bands that Sharon portrays in her book, and she definitely got it right. Something that I will certainly read again!

A labor of love By Amazon Customer Since I came of age in the Pacific Northwest (Seattle, not Portland)in the early 80's, I had at least a passing familiarity with much of what was written in You Had To Be There. The author does an excellent job of capturing the vibe of what it was like to be young and part of a thriving music scene. Many passages had me nodding my head and saying "Yes, I remember that." You don't need to be familiar with any of the bands to enjoy this book - you just have to be able to remember what it's like to be young, alive and feeling like you're part of the music.
